Transaction 100859f382466c8816286fb9828936c7a54ce18f94e471976fcee0bc76280210
1 Input
1 Output
-
100859f382466c8816286fb9828936c7a54ce18f94e471976fcee0bc76280210:0
- value
- 635475
- script pubkey
- OP_0 OP_PUSHBYTES_20 f47bfacb6c9e6d75d5ab31995899f300ef03895b
- address
- bc1q73al4jmvnekht4dtxxv43x0nqrhs8z2m6fnhp5